INFOCUS TECHNICAL SPECIFICATIONS*
COMPATIBILITY
Video:  
Component and RGB HDTV (720p, 1035i, 1080i, 1080p-24Hz), 24p.  
DVI/HDMI with HDCP for digital video and encrypted digital video.  
Component EDTV (480p, 576p progressive scan), Component,  
Composite and S-Video standard video (480i, 576i, RGB SCART with adapter, NTSC, 
NTSC M 4.43, PAL: B, G, H, I, M, N; SECAM: M] including 60Hz to 48Hz conversion of 
NTSC film-based content
Computer:  
Digital and analog PC, Macintosh
®
, 1280 x 1024 resolution through intelligent resizing
Communication:  
USB and RS-232
INPUTS & OUTPUTS
2 - Component (Gold RCA): HDTV, EDTV, and Standard TV component
1 - Component (D5):  
HDTV, EDTV, Standard TV, and RGB SCART with adapter
2 - S-Video:  
Standard Video
1 - Composite (RCA):  
Standard Video
1 - DVI (M1):  
HDTV RGB, HDTV Component, Digital Visual Interface (DVI) with HDCP decryption, 
computer, and USB, HDMI via available adapter
1 - HD15 VESA:  
HDTV RGB, HDTV component, and computer
1 - 9-pin Dsub Male:  
RS-232
1 - 3.5mm Mini-Jack:  
IR Repeater (Niles/Xantech compatible)
2 - 3.5mm Mini-Jack:  
1–12v screen-drop, 1–12v 4:3 aspect “curtains”
DISPLAY
Projection System:  
720p+ DC3 DLP
®
 from Texas Instruments
®
Resolution:  
1280 x 720 (16:9)
Projection Lens:  
All glass, Zeiss designed. F/2.7 (wide), F/3.1 (tele)
Color Wheel:  
Proprietary, variable speed 7-segment color wheel, (6500K color temperature)
Calibrated Contrast Ratio:   2800:1 full on/full off
Lamp (dual mode)**:  
220-Watt UHP (3000 hours); 250-Watt UHP (2000 hours)
Video Optimized Lumens:   1100 ANSI max
Modes:  
Front/rear/ceiling mode
Focusing Distance:  
5'/ 1.5m to 7m
Keystone Correction:  
Digital, up to +/- 20° vertical, +/- 9° horizontal
SMPTE Brightness:  
Up to 132"/ 3.35m wide, 16:9 screen
Throw Ratio:  
1.67:1 – 2.08:1 (distance/width)
GENERAL
Size:  
13.8" (W) x 12.8" (L) x 4.3" (H)/ 351cm x 325cm x 110cm
Weight:  
9.5 lbs/4.3kg
Power Supply:  
100V – 240V at 50 – 60 Hz
Operating Temperature:   10° – 40° C at sea level (0 – 10,000’); 50° – 104° F
Conformances:  
UL, CSA, TUV, C Tick, NOM, MIC, GOST, IRAM, CCC, S-JQA, FCC B, EN55022, ICES-003
Ships Standard with:  
Power cord, director remote, cable cover
Warranty:  
Two-year standard warranty on parts and labor, 90 day on accessories
Lamp Warranty:  
90 days
Menu Languages:  
English, Spanish, French, German, Japanese, Korea, Portuguese, Italian, Norwegian, 
Russian, Chinese Simple, Chinese Traditional

**   Actual lamp life may vary based on the ambient environment. Conditions that may affect lamp life include 
temperature, altitude, and rapidly switching the projector on and off.
